Maintaining square waveguide systems is essential for ensuring optimal performance in various applications, from radar systems to satellite communications. These systems are known for their efficiency in transmitting microwave signals with minimal loss, but like any other equipment, they require regular servicing to keep them functioning at their best.
First, let’s talk about inspection. Regular visual checks are crucial. Look for any signs of physical damage, such as dents or corrosion, which can affect signal integrity. Pay close attention to the flange connections, as misalignment or loose bolts can lead to signal leakage. If you spot any issues, address them immediately to prevent further damage.
Cleaning is another critical aspect. Dust, moisture, and other contaminants can accumulate inside the waveguide, leading to signal degradation. Use a soft brush or compressed air to remove debris, and ensure the interior surfaces are free from oxidation. For stubborn dirt, a mild solvent can be used, but avoid abrasive materials that could scratch the waveguide’s inner surfaces.
Next, check the seals and gaskets. Over time, these components can wear out, allowing moisture or dust to enter the system. Replacing them periodically is a simple yet effective way to maintain the waveguide’s performance. Also, ensure that all connections are tight and properly aligned to prevent signal loss.
Testing is a key part of servicing square waveguide systems. Use a network analyzer to measure the insertion loss and return loss. If the readings are outside the specified range, it could indicate a problem with the waveguide or its components. Regularly testing the system helps identify issues before they escalate, saving time and money in the long run.

Finally, keep a maintenance log. Documenting inspections, cleanings, and repairs helps track the system’s health over time and ensures nothing is overlooked. This practice is particularly useful for large-scale installations where multiple waveguides are in use.
